Medium-duty beverage trucks deliver on propane

Five medium-duty beverage trucks fueled by propane autogas began operation at Nestlé Waters North America’s Los Angeles location. The trucks will deliver Arrowhead Mountain Spring Water to area businesses and residents.

The location utilizes on-site refueling for its diesel-powered trucks, and the company has chosen to add an on-site propane autogas fueling station, as well. Nestlé Waters purchased the medium-duty chassis from Midway Ford and upfitted the vehicle with a side-load beverage body at Mickey Truck Bodies in High Point, N.C. Each unit is equipped with a Roush CleanTech propane autogas fuel system that provides a 45-usable gallon fuel tank. The water delivery company operates more than 2,000 trucks throughout the nation that are primarily fueled by diesel.
